List of Works Exhibited

1. The Stoning of Saint Steven
Oil on panel, 89.5 x 123.6 cm
1625
Lyon, Musée des Beaux Arts
2. Christ driving the Money-changers from the Temple
Oil on panel, 43.1 x 33 cm
1626
Moscow, The State Pushkin Museum of Fine Arts
3. Two old Men disputing
Oil on panel, 2,4 x 59,7 cm
Ca.1628
Melbourne, The National Gallery of Victoria
4. Judas giving back the 30 Silver Coins
Oil on panel, 79 x 102.3 cm
1629
Private collection
5. David playing the Harp before Saul
Oil on panel, 62.2 x 50.5 cm
ca. 1629-1630
Frankfurt, Städelsches Kunstinstitut und Städtische Galerie
6. Jeremiah lamenting the Destruction of Jerusalem
Oil on panel, 58.3 x 46.6 cm
1630
Amsterdam, Rijksmuseum
7. Saint Peter in Prison
Oil on panel, 59.1 x 47.8 cm
1631
Jerusalem, Israel Museum
8. Simeon in the Temple
Oil on panel, 60.9 x 47.8 cm
1631
The Hague, Mauritshuis Royal Cabinet of Paintings
9. Self-portrait in Oriental Dress
Oil on panel, 81 x 54 cm
1631
Paris, Musée des Beaux Arts de la Ville de Paris, Petit Palais
10. The Rape of Europa
Oil on panel, 62.2 x 77 cm
1632
Los Angeles, CA, The J. Paul Getty Museum
11. Young Woman at her Toilet
Oil on canvas, 108 x 92 cm
Ca. 1633
Ottawa, The National Gallery of Canada
12. The Descent from the Cross
Etching (second State), 513 x 410 mm
1633
Madrid, Biblioteca Nacional
13. Daniel and Cyrus before the Idol Bel
Oil on panel, 23 x 30 cm
1633
Los Angeles, CA, The J. Paul Getty Museum
14. Bellona
Oil on canvas, 127 x 97.5 cm
1633
New York, The Metropolitan Museum of Art
15. Artemisa
Oil on canvas, 143 x 154.7 cm
1634
Madrid, Museo Nacional del Prado
16. Ecce Homo
Oil on paper attached to canvas, 54.5 x 44.5 cm
1634
London, National Gallery
17. Christ before Pilate
Etching and engraving (second state; B. 77, II), 54.9 x 44.7 cm
1635-36
Washington D.C., National Gallery of Art, Rosenwald Collection
18. Lamentation at the Foot of the Cross
Oil on paper attached to panel, 31.9 x 26.7 cm
1634-35
London, National Gallery
19.Minerva
Oil on canvas, 137 x 116 cm
1635
Private collection, New York
20. Belshazzar’s feast
Oil on canvas, 167.6 x 209.2 cm
Ca.1635
London, National Gallery
21. The Holy Family
Oil on canvas, 183.5 x 123 cm
Ca.1635
Munich, Alte Pinakothek
22. Susanna
Oil on panel, 47.2 x 38.6 cm
1636
The Hague, Mauritshuis Royal Cabinet of Paintings
23. Samson and Delilah
Oil on canvas, 206 x 276 cm
1636
Frankfurt, Städelsches Kunstinstitut und Städtische Galerie
24. The Burial of Christ
Oil on canvas, 92.6 x 68.9 cm
Ca. 1636-39
Munich, Alte Pinakothek
25. The Marriage of Samson
Oil on canvas, 126.5 x 175.5 cm
1638
Dresden, Gemäldegalerie
26. Christ and the Woman taken in Adultery
Oil on panel, 83.8 x 65.4 cm
1644
London, National Gallery
27. The Holy Family
Oil on canvas, 117 x 91 cm
1645
Saint Petersburg, State Hermitage Museum
28. Rest on the Flight into Egypt
Oil on panel, 34 x 48 cm
1647
Dublin, National Gallery of Ireland
29. Christ
Oil on panel, 25 x 21.5 cm
ca. 1650-1652
Berlin, Staatliche Museen Preussischer Kulturbesitz, Gemäldegalerie
30. Christ healing the Sick (the Hundred Guilder Print)
Drypoint and engraving, 278 x 388 mm
Ca. 1648
Amsterdam, Rijksmuseum
31. Christ Crucified between the Two Thieves: The three Crosses
Drypoint and engraving, (fourth state), 385 x 450 mm
1653
New York, The Metropolitan Museum of Art, Acc.41.1.33, Gift of Felix M. Warburg and his family, 1941
32. Bathsheba
Oil on canvas, 142 x 142 cm
1654
Paris, Musée du Louvre
33. Flora
Oil on canvas, 100 x 91.8 cm
Ca. 1654
New York, The Metropolitan Museum of Art
34. Christ Presented to the People
Drypoint (eighth state), 358 x 455 mm
1655
Amsterdam, Rijksmuseum
35. The Apostle Bartholomew
Oil on canvas, 122.7 x 99.7cm
1657
San Diego, CA, The Timken Museum of Art
36. The Apostle Paul
Oil on canvas, 131.5 x 104.4 cm
Late 1650s
Washington DC, National Gallery of Art
37. Moses with the Tablets of the Law
Oil on canvas, 168 x 135 cm
Ca. 1659
Berlin, Gemäldegalerie
38. Saint Peter denying Christ
Oil on panel, 154 x 169 cm
1660
Amsterdam, Rijksmuseum
39. The Circumcision
Oil on canvas, 56.5 x 75 cm
1661
Washington DC, National Gallery of Art
40. Self-Portrait as Zeuxis
Oil on canvas, 82.5 x 65 cm
Ca. 1663 - 1664
Cologne, Wallraf-Richartz Museum - Fondation Corboud
